Between 1941 and 1958, Nabokov taught literature at Wellesley and Cornell. His lectures were legendary—not for their academic dryness, but for their volcanic subjectivity. He didn't just teach books; he dissected them like a lepidopterist examining a rare butterfly. Today, these lectures are compiled in two essential volumes: Lectures on Literature (covering Austen, Dickens, Flaubert, Joyce, Kafka, and Proust) and Lectures on Russian Literature (covering Gogol, Turgenev, Dostoevsky, Tolstoy, and Chekhov).
